    Hubby and I decided to go for take out Chinese here since we both had a day off due to the New Years. Actually we heard of this place during our meal at Beijing before they closed permanently. We overheard from a customer across our table. We arrived before the dinner rush. Quickly seated and quickly ordered our food. The food arrived pretty quick also. We ordered the potstickers, garlic chicken, Mongolian beef and sweet and sour pork. They were all delish. No hair....no bugs.....dinner was perfect. This place was very quaint. It's a typical mom n pop Chinese restaurant. I see why they have a loyal following of customers. Unfortunately we live a bit far from this place. We will definitely come back next time we are in town for Chinese. There are VERY few good Chinese restaurants in Central Valley. Price: A Quality: A++ Service: A+ The only down side out of our experience is the limited selection in their menu. They have the same dish as with most Chinese restaurant which is why I couldn't give more than 4 stars.

    Came to Dynasty Garden after doing a quick "dim sum" search in Modesto. I had been craving dim sum…read morefor some time and since we were in town, I figured why not try somewhere new to me? Walking in on a Saturday afternoon (it was almost 3PM when we entered), you're met with a check-in counter. The inside is decorated much like a typical Chinese restaurant: round tables w a lazy susan, dark moody carpet, and infrastructure/roof tiling on the back wall that makes it look like we're dining right outside a traditional cafe in China. We were quickly seated and brought a regular menu and a dim sum menu. I liked that the dim sum menu contained pictures for easy point and order. But instead of pointing like a normal person, I brought out my broken Canto to order and I think I impressed uncle enough to get a complimentary bowl of egg flower soup lol. We ended up ordering: - Orange chicken lunch special: this comes with white rice or you can upgrade to fried rice or chow mein for an extra dollar. SO upgraded to chow mein and the plate that came out was HUGE. Was not expecting such a large portion, but I am not complaining at all. The chicken was sauced perfectly and he said the noodles were aight. - Ha gow (shrimp dumpling): these had thicker wrapping, but the dumplings themselves were stuffed. Good flavor - Shu mai (pork and shrimp dumpling): meaty, yummy. The skins sorta stuck to the bottom container though - Fong zhao (chicken feet): super delicious, but only came with 3 measly claws - Ham sui gok (fried glutinous rice pork dumpling): fried mochi goodness with delicious meat filling (even if the filling was a little sparse) - Gou choy gow (chive dumpling): my personal favorite dim sum dish; the one here was not my favorite, but it did its job. - Salt and pepper pork spareribs: we ordered this as an alternative when they told me they were out of their pineapple custard bun (bolo bao)... don't ask me how I went from dessert to this, but I liked it. The meat was kinda thin, but the flavor was there. We happened to have our meal right when the staff was having theirs right behind us. So by the time we were ready for the check, we kind of sat around waiting for someone to check on us. Our total came to about $60. I noticed that 2 of the dim sum dishes were marked as "large", at about $6.10 per dish. I wish this was posted on the dim sum menu somewhere... I only saw the $5.50 price tag. Overall, Dynasty Garden nostalgically reminds me of home, so I would definitely return.

    Been ages since I've been here but decided to come here for lunch to introduce it to my employee…read morewho has never been there. We came around 1 pm but the meat and vegetable counter was neat and tidy. The meats to choose are beef, pork, chicken and turkey. To get your moneys worth, you have to stack your meats, vegetables and noodles in one bowl for it to be personally cooked on the large flat grill. Your Mongolian bbq includes one scoop of rice, one gzyoza and egg flower soup. One bowl is part of the price but if you wanted a second round, it's only an additional $2 which is a good deal. Everyone had noodles that you can take home if you don't finish. Overall, everyone enjoyed Mongolian bbq and the newbie said she can't wait to go back here for lunch.

    We haven't been here in forever but I love this place. If I am craving Chinese/Sushi etc I prefer…read moreto go here. $16.99 per person with refills. Easy to control portions, carbs, proteins, veggies, etc. You typically need a lot of sauce so be careful there for the sodium but otherwise a great, fun healthy option. The area in front of the noodles can get messy if people do not be careful but otherwise the restaurant is nice and clean, great music choices, awesome service. Servers and cooks are really nice, bring cash for the cooks or specify on your tip which portion is for cooks and which is for servers. Good for groups, dates, or treating yourself. Even better on cold and rainy days!
